Introduction: Immigration is a matter of regulating the traffic of people entering or leaving the Territory of the Republic of Indonesia and its supervision in the context of maintaining state sovereignty.Purposes of the Research: Review and analyze the Regulations of Law Number 6 of 2011 concerning Immigration regarding the supervision of Foreigners in Indonesia.Methods of the Research: Scientific writing is carried out using research methods, with normative juridical research types, problem approaches using case approaches and law approaches, primary, secondary and tertiary sources of legal materials and techniques for collecting and managing legal materials using library research by searching and reviewing books. related to solving the problem in this writing.Results of the Research: Foreigners who enter illegally into the territory of the State of Indonesia are foreigners who enter without going through the inspection of immigration officials and without being accompanied by valid and still valid travel documents, this is a development burden for the government in solving these problems. This can be seen and studied in the Immigration Act by looking at the arrangements for the supervision of foreigners and the imposition of sanctions on immigration crimes committed. Immigration in carrying out its duties and authorities must be more assertive in handling and providing sanctions to foreigners who commit immigration violations and crimes in accordance with Law No. in giving sanctions to someone who commits an immigration crime.
